Artbreeder

Artbreeder operates on a different philosophy, centered around the concept of generative art through genetic-like mixing and mutation. Originally launched as Ganbreeder, its history is rooted in exploring the creative potential of Generative Adversarial Networks (GANs). Artbreeder's mission is to be a collaborative tool for creative exploration. Its core offerings include the "Mixer," which allows users to blend multiple images, and the "Splicer," which lets them combine images and edit their "genes" using intuitive sliders. This approach makes it a unique platform for discovering unexpected visual combinations and creating surreal, painterly, or photorealistic art.

Performance Benchmarking

While performance can fluctuate, general trends can be observed.

  • Processing Speed: Chichi-pui, like many text-to-image platforms, has processing times that depend on server load and subscription tier, but it is generally fast. Artbreeder's generation is often near-instantaneous, especially when adjusting genes, as the core computations are less complex than generating a new image from a text prompt.
  • Output Consistency: Chichi-pui excels at output consistency, particularly when generating the same character in different poses—a significant challenge in AI art. Artbreeder's consistency depends on the user's ability to manipulate genes carefully; its nature is more exploratory than precise.
  • Scalability: Both platforms are built on cloud infrastructure and are designed to handle heavy workloads. For large-scale batch processing, their respective APIs are the most effective solution.
